This was required for my psych rotation and initially I almost didn't buy it (many classes have extra texts that you don't really need - I thought this might be one...) However, our professor emphasized that the psych dx in regular nursing care plan books aren't right & don't have all that pertain specifically to psych/mental health and lack correct interventions.

As it turns out, I used this little book significantly more than I used the primary text for the class! It has info on the various psych drugs with indications & things to watch out for, info on appropriate communication styles when dealing with individuals displaying particular behaviours incl. therapeutic communication, descriptions of all the various defense mechanisms etc. It's really worth the $$$.

This is one text I will keep beyond nursing school for easy reference to all things psych.

This text book is outstanding in terms of clear pictures and detailed descriptions. It exhibits numerous color photos which help remember the clinical signs and appearances of common infectious diseases. On the other hand, the text excellently outlines and explains the underlying theory and treatments. This book takes a modern approach to teach Microbiology by introducing the contents in a system based mannar. This is very different from the traditional way of teaching the subject in which the materials are delivered species by species. I think this way is more clinically relevant and thus, suits the needs of health care students.

After reading this book I thought that it deserved a special review, this is, not the type of review that usually begins with "a must read for every clinician" but something special as this book deserves. Most of us have had already the necessity of accessing Medline database in our research but most of the times we get hit by the results that a simple search presents. We then start browsing and browsing the results and we get tired of so much information that some times does not correspond to our desires or doesn't focus on the subject we were looking for. Now what? - we ask. The answer is simple as the author says; the focus is not just on simple searching but on effective searching. Medline is a complex and very wide database and knowing some of its basic concepts will help us understanding how simple and effective can our search be made. This is what the author presents in this book, a "rutter" for easy and effective navigation in this complex and wide sea of scientific information. There are no secrets in Medline but there are basic concepts like knowing some of the 19,000 Medical Subject Headings (MeSH) or just simple understanding how they are organized and how this understanding will help us to get the effective search results for our needs. This is given by the author with many examples of ways to start an effective search in Medline and thus not waste so much of our precious time browsing through the great amount of information that this resource can present. The book is very accessible in the way that the concepts are presented with many examples and a glossary for quick reference on MeSH. In a couple of hours the reader will with no doubt find this book from Brian S. Katcher an excellent guide and a valuable acquisition. I must say that after reading it, I finally understood how much precious time I've wasted in my "not guided" Medline searches. Now things are easier and clear thanks to the time, the knowledge and the effort that the author has put in this book.

the MedSurg Notes pocket guide is a great small BUT compact reference....you have everything in the palm of your hand that covers the following:

1) basics (legal issues, cpr (adult & child),choking, emergency care positions, manual defibrillation, AEDs, Artificial airways, etc)

2) Cardio area covers many conditions a few are arterial hematoma, bradycardia, dehydration, Fever with SIRS/Sepsis, Hemorrhage, hypokalemia, etc

3)Resp area (a few are aspiration, Dyspnea/SOB, Hypoventilation, etc)

4) Neuro area ( Change in Mental Status/Delirium, Dizziness, Head Trauma, ICP, etc)

5) GI/GU Metab (Diarrhea, Feeding tube, Upper GI bleeding, etc)

6) MSKEL/INTEG (Pathological fracture, patient fall, spinal cord trauma, etc)

7) Medications (the ones commonly used in MedSurg units)

8)Tools area that has many tools we use to assess the client with such as braden scale risk assessment, wound assessment guide, Glasgow Coma scale etc


Overall great product for a nursing student or RN...and worth the money!
